Transaction 83d88b8a1a34a904e563eec62c13d76923acd995c005503101344fe8159543ef
1 Input
1 Output
-
83d88b8a1a34a904e563eec62c13d76923acd995c005503101344fe8159543ef:0
- value
- 24601397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26257494c1f9dd1b54b98e8dbb71b1b9fb3ecf6c OP_EQUAL
- address
- MBNrnAbMrJuCm2wMRrfK3g3gAHVRRFoLVq